LTpowerPlay QUICK START PROCEDURE
The following procedure describes how to use LTpowerPlay
to monitor and change the settings of LT7182S.
1. Download and install the LTPowerPlay GUI:
LTpowerPlay | Analog Devices
2. Launch the LTpowerPlay GUI.
a. The GUI should automatically identify the DC2836A.
The system tree on the left hand side should look
like this:
b. A green message box shows for a few seconds in
the lower left hand corner, confirming that LT7182S
is communicating:
c. In the Toolbar, click the R (RAM to PC) icon to read
the RAM from the LT7182S. This reads the configu-
ration from the RAM of LT7182S and loads it into
the GUI.

d. If you want to change the output voltage to a differ-
ent value, like 1.5V. In the Config tab, type in 1.5 in
the VOUT_COMMAND box, like this:
Then, click the W (PC to RAM) icon to write these reg-
ister values to the LT7182S. After finishing this step,
you will see the output voltage will change to 1.5V.
If the write is successful, you will see the following
message:
e. You can save the changes into the NVM. In the tool
bar, click RAM to NVM button, as following
f. Save the demo board configuration to a (*.proj) file.
Click the Save icon and save the file. Name it what-
ever you want.
